Shaheen, JoAnn C. – Social Education, 1989
Describes a Student Advisory Council which was established to address the problems of the Cottage Lane Elementary School (Blauvelt, New York) and its students. Contends that through this participatory activity, students are learning how to solve public problems. (SLM)

Lolla, Raymond S.; Miller, D. Glen – Man/Society/Technology, 1980
Using the design and production of a ceramic container as a student activity, the authors present a method to involve industrial arts students in creative problem solving. Students are provided with a problem that requires them to inventory their industrial arts facilities and available materials to solve the problem. (CT)

Leung, Shukkwan S.; Wu, Rui-xiang – Mathematics Teaching in the Middle School, 1999
Shares two lessons in which students help teachers pose problems and discover the importance of posing problems properly. Presents a fifth-grade lesson in which students found a mistake in a proportion problem, and an eighth-grade lesson that discusses a geometry problem with insufficient information. (ASK)
